CardPresso ID Card Software is a modular credential design and printing solution that scales across five editions—XXS, XS, XM, XL, and XXL—allowing organizations to choose functionality based on their ID issuance needs. It provides a flexible framework for creating, managing, and printing secure identification cards across small to enterprise-level environments.
The XXS edition delivers core ID card creation and printing capabilities, including template-based design, text and data input tools, barcode support (1D), signature capture, and basic database functionality with an internal document database and photo linking. It also supports WIA, TWAIN, and DirectShow for image acquisition and includes magnetic stripe encoding.
The XS edition expands functionality with QR code support, document password protection, production mode, and external database connectivity through XLS, XLSX, CSV, and TXT file formats. This allows for improved data handling and streamlined card production workflows.
The XM edition introduces MS Access and SQLite connectivity, 2D barcode support, FaceCrop facial recognition tools, and the ability to store photos directly in databases. It is designed for more advanced small-to-mid-scale deployments requiring improved data integration and automation.
The XL edition adds enterprise-focused capabilities such as ODBC connectivity, RFID and smart card encoding, fingerprint capture, multi-layout card designs, auto-print functionality, and user permission controls. It also supports both internal and external RFID encoding devices, making it suitable for secure credential environments.
The XXL edition provides the most advanced feature set, including DESFire encoding support, web print server functionality, and network licensing for up to 16 PCs within the same subnet. It is designed for distributed, high-security environments requiring centralized management and scalable issuance capabilities.
